What Is the Cost of Living Near Newton?

Understanding the cost of living near Newton is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at NNHS Student Faculty Administration.
Newton's Cost of Living Index is approximately 201.5 (101.5% more expensive than US average; 52.0% more than MA average). Affluent Boston suburb, excellent schools, extremely high housing costs. MBTA Green Line/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from NNHS Student Faculty Administration,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,900 - $4,500+ A significant portion of NNHS Student Faculty Administration sal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$190 - $300 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$90 (MBTA LinkPass mon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$530 - $820 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$650 - $1,200+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$470 - $900+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,830 - $7,720+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
